Live Dealer Tables: Evolution Versus Pragmatic Play

Evolution Gaming remains the market leader for live roulette in the UK. Their Immersive Roulette offers multiple camera angles and slow-motion replays. Pragmatic Play, however, has closed the gap significantly since 2024. Their Speed Roulette tables deal a hand in under 15 seconds, which suits players who want volume over theatrics.

Both providers use RNG-certified wheels that are tested by iTech Labs and eCOGRA. We verified this on the respective provider websites. Evolution’s streams run at 1080p with a 60 fps cap on desktop. Pragmatic Play defaults to 30 fps on mobile unless you manually switch to ‘High Quality’ in the settings menu. A small detail, but it matters when you’re tracking numbers across multiple tables.

>Key Differences in Table Limits and Bet Options

  • Evolution tables start at £0.10 inside bets and go up to £10,000 on select VIP tables.
  • Pragmatic Play tables cap outside bets at £5,000, but their minimum is often £0.50.
  • Both providers offer ‘Racetrack’ betting for French roulette variants.
  • Evolution includes a ‘Statistics’ panel that shows hot/cold numbers over the last 500 spins.
  • Pragmatic Play integrates a ‘Bet Behind’ feature for players who want to copy high-roller bets.

Some players prefer the clean interface of Evolution. Others find the Pragmatic Play lobby easier to navigate on a mobile browser. It is a subjective call, but we lean toward Evolution for stream stability during high-traffic periods.

>Security Audit: Two-Factor Authentication and Encryption

Only four of the seven casinos we tested offer mandatory two-factor authentication (2FA). Sky Vegas and 888 Casino require it on account login. William Hill and Coral offer it as an optional setting. MrQ, 32Red, and PlayOJO currently only support 2FA via email verification, which is weaker than app-based authenticators.

All seven use 256-bit SSL encryption, verified via the padlock icon in the browser. The UKGC requires this under the Licence Conditions and Codes of practice (LCCP). We also checked the privacy policies for data retention periods. Most hold personal data for six years after account closure, which is standard under UK law.

Mobile Performance and Stream Quality

We tested live roulette on an iPhone 14 Pro and a Samsung Galaxy S23 using 4G and Wi-Fi. Evolution’s streams loaded in under three seconds on both devices. Pragmatic Play’s lobby took slightly longer, around five seconds, but the stream quality was consistent at 720p on mobile.

One issue we noticed: at 888 Casino, the live roulette stream dropped to 480p during peak hours (8 PM to 11 PM BST). The audio remained clear, but the visual quality degraded noticeably. This did not happen at MrQ or William Hill, even during the same time window. It may be a bandwidth allocation issue on 888’s side.

If you’re a mobile-first player, we recommend MrQ or PlayOJO for the smoothest experience. Both casinos use Evolution’s adaptive bitrate streaming, which adjusts resolution based on your connection speed without buffering.

Banking Options for Real-Money Play

UKGC regulations require all deposits to be made from a UK bank account or debit card. Credit cards are banned under the Gambling Act 2005. The fastest withdrawal method remains e-wallets like PayPal and Skrill. MrQ processes e-wallet withdrawals in under 24 hours. Sky Vegas and 888 Casino are slightly slower, averaging 14 to 20 hours.

Bank transfers take one to three business days at most operators. We tested a £50 withdrawal via bank transfer at 32Red. It arrived in two working days. Not bad, but not instant. If you need the cash quickly, stick to e-wallets.
